Did anyone purchase the extended warranty with their ZR2. I took delivery late Monday(I'll throw up some pics later, it went straight to tint shop and for some other goodies) and I passed on the Extended Warranty at that time. Now I am kind of reconsidering it. The only car I have ever bought an extended warranty on was my Lexus LC and that was mainly because of the cost to replace either of the digital screens and some of the other tech. Started thinking about all the new tech in the Silverado's and the DSSV shocks on the ZR2 so it got me to reconsidering. Anyone buy or have specific reason they didn't buy an extended warranty?
 
I didn't get one either. I haven't decided yet if I'm going to. No reason to buy it right away. You can get it anytime as long as your still under the manufacturers bumper to bumper.

I have mixed feelings on them really. I've had them before and it's kind of hit or miss. Sometimes they will cover you and save you some cash. But they can also deny stuff they shouldn't and they can be a hassle. They are a huge money maker. They don't make all that profit by paying out. But at the same time, I'm like you. With all the tech in this truck and the obvious expense if it fails out of warranty. Might be worth the gamble on a 2k warranty? Lol like I said I'm still undecided also.
